The Performative Harmony Of Scam 1992: The Harshad Mehta Story

  • Posted on November 4, 2020January 23, 2021
  • by Rahul Desai
The most significant aspect of Scam 1992 is its supporting cast . Almost every bit-role is played with fresh precision by a familiar face – by veterans who’ve long been typecast as loud character actors, or miscast as leads, in mainstream Hindi cinema.

Film Companion is India’s leading English language entertainment journalism platform. The platform, which includes text and video, is a celebration of the movies and storytelling. Film Companion is pan-India and covers entertainment from across the country and abroad. It’s a platform committed to quality with balanced, well-researched journalism. The hallmark is credibility. The team includes two National Award-winning journalists – Anupama Chopra and Baradwaj Rangan. Film Companion brings you engaging and informative content on movies that includes, reviews of films and web shows, interviews, film festival news, features and masterclasses.
